Any instructional program in rehabilitation and therapeutic professions not listed above.
California grants the most Post masters certificates in Rehabilitation and Therapeutic Professions, Other of all US states with 3 degrees being awarded last year. Students interested in Rehabilitation and Therapeutic Professions, Other can expect around 0% percent of their fellow classmates to be men and 100% percent to be women. Most students graduating in this field earn a Bachelors degree. The average starting salary for an undergraduate degree in Rehabilitation and Therapeutic Professions, Other is $38,300.
Some top careers related to Rehabilitation and Therapeutic Professions, Other, include Therapists, All Other, which are in high demand. Though there are higher paying positions, like Health Specialties Teachers, Postsecondary. The most in-demand position for Rehabilitation and Therapeutic Professions, Other majors is Health Specialties Teachers, Postsecondary.
